What is the path forward from Sierra Leone Psychiatric Teaching Hospital--especially in the face of persistent stigma against mental health conditions? For a growing number of patients, the step after leaving inpatient care is to become a community health worker (CHW), providing support to those currently admitted to the hospital. To learn more about this new community health worker program, we talk with Dr. Abdul Jalloh, psychiatrist and medical superintendent of Sierra Leone Psychiatric Teaching Hospital, and Agness Sumaila and Hawa Kabia, two current CHWs whose work is helping them rebuild their lives.
